Airbnb has just released their annual list of the most liked properties on their Instagram and they are guaranteed to make you want to book a flight and get the hell out of here.
The Airbnbs range from houseboats on the Danube River to isolated cabins in the depths of the mountains to picturesque villas in France. They’re boujie, aesthetically appealing and usually provide a unique experience.
They may not necessarily be the ones constantly booked up but they are easily the most popular on Instagram by a mile.
These are the top 10 most liked Airbnbs on Instagram last year:
Zion EcoCabin, Utah, USA
This Airbnb is truly secluded in the Zion mountains but close enough to a town to get supplies. It sleeps two people, has a hot tub, fire pit and just straight up incredible views.
